Understanding Prebiotics: An Overview

Before delving into the connection between prebiotics and weight loss, it is important to have a clear understanding of what prebiotics are and their role in the human body.

Prebiotics are a type of dietary fiber that are primarily found in certain plants, such as chicory root, Jerusalem artichokes, and asparagus. They are not digested in the small intestine, but instead reach the colon intact.

Once in the colon, prebiotics serve as a source of nourishment for the beneficial bacteria that reside there. These bacteria ferment the prebiotics, producing short-chain fatty acids (SCFAs) as a byproduct. SCFAs provide energy for the cells of the colon and have numerous health benefits.

Furthermore, prebiotics play a crucial role in maintaining a healthy gut microbiota, which is essential for overall health. The gut microbiota is a complex community of microorganisms that reside in our digestive tract. It consists of trillions of bacteria, fungi, and viruses, collectively known as the gut microbiome. The balance of this microbiome is vital for various aspects of our health, including digestion, immune function, and even mental well-being.

Different Types of Prebiotics

There are several different types of prebiotics, all with unique properties that contribute to their overall health benefits.

Some common types of prebiotics include:

  1. Inulin: Found in foods such as chicory root, garlic, and onions. Inulin is a soluble fiber that is known for its ability to promote the growth of beneficial bacteria in the gut. It has a slightly sweet taste and is often used as a natural sweetener in certain food products.
  2. FOS (fructooligosaccharides): Found in foods like bananas, oats, and barley. FOS is a type of prebiotic fiber that is resistant to digestion in the small intestine. It reaches the colon intact, where it is fermented by the gut bacteria. FOS has been shown to increase the production of SCFAs, which can have a positive impact on gut health.
  3. GOS (galactooligosaccharides): Found in breast milk and certain legumes. GOS is a prebiotic fiber that is naturally present in breast milk and can also be derived from certain legumes, such as lentils and chickpeas. It has been shown to selectively stimulate the growth of beneficial bacteria in the gut, promoting a healthy gut microbiota.

The Connection Between Prebiotics and Weight Loss

Research has uncovered a compelling connection between prebiotics and weight loss. Although the exact mechanisms are still being explored, there are several ways in which prebiotics can influence metabolism and appetite regulation.

Prebiotics are a type of dietary fiber that cannot be digested by the human body. Instead, they serve as a source of nourishment for beneficial bacteria in the gut. These bacteria, known as probiotics, play a crucial role in maintaining a healthy digestive system and overall well-being.

How Prebiotics Influence Metabolism

Prebiotics have the potential to increase energy expenditure and fat oxidation, contributing to weight loss efforts. Animal studies have shown that prebiotic supplementation can enhance the production of short-chain fatty acids (SCFAs), which stimulate the release of hormones that regulate metabolism.

SCFAs, such as acetate, propionate, and butyrate, are produced when probiotics ferment prebiotics in the gut. These SCFAs have been found to activate specific receptors in the body, including G-protein coupled receptors (GPCRs) and free fatty acid receptors (FFARs). The activation of these receptors triggers a cascade of events that promote fat breakdown and utilization, leading to increased energy expenditure.

Additionally, prebiotics have been found to alter the gut microbiota composition in ways that favorably impact metabolism. They promote the growth of bacteria that are associated with a lean body composition, such as Bacteroidetes, while suppressing the growth of bacteria linked to obesity, such as Firmicutes.

Prebiotics and Appetite Regulation

Another aspect of prebiotics' impact on weight management lies in their ability to regulate appetite and food intake.

Studies have shown that prebiotics can influence the production of hunger and satiety hormones, such as ghrelin and leptin. Ghrelin is often referred to as the "hunger hormone" because it stimulates appetite, while leptin is known as the "satiety hormone" because it signals feelings of fullness.

By modulating these hormones, prebiotics can help to reduce cravings, increase feelings of fullness, and ultimately lead to a lower calorie intake. This can be particularly beneficial for individuals who struggle with overeating or have difficulty controlling their appetite.

Furthermore, prebiotics have been shown to improve gut barrier function, which plays a crucial role in preventing the absorption of harmful substances and toxins from the gut into the bloodstream. A healthy gut barrier can help reduce inflammation, which is often associated with obesity and metabolic disorders.

The Science Behind Prebiotics and Weight Management

The connection between prebiotics and weight management goes beyond just metabolism and appetite regulation. Prebiotics also play a crucial role in maintaining a healthy gut and supporting the immune system, both of which are essential for managing weight effectively.

The Impact of Prebiotics on Gut Health

A healthy gut is essential for overall well-being, and prebiotics can have a profound impact on gut health. By nourishing the beneficial bacteria in our gut, prebiotics help to maintain a balanced microbial community.

This balance not only improves digestion but also enhances the gut's ability to absorb nutrients effectively. Research has shown that a healthy gut microbiota is associated with a lower risk of obesity and metabolic disorders.

In addition to promoting a balanced microbial community, prebiotics also have a positive effect on gut motility. They help to regulate the movement of food through the digestive system, preventing issues such as constipation and promoting regular bowel movements.

Furthermore, prebiotics have been found to increase the production of butyrate, a short-chain fatty acid that provides energy to the cells lining the colon. This energy source helps to maintain the integrity of the gut barrier, preventing the leakage of harmful substances into the bloodstream.

Prebiotics and the Immune System: A Link to Weight Management

The gut microbiota plays a vital role in the functioning of our immune system. A well-balanced gut microbiota helps to keep the immune system in check, preventing chronic inflammation and other immune-related issues.

Furthermore, prebiotics have been found to stimulate the production of short-chain fatty acids, which have anti-inflammatory properties. By reducing inflammation, prebiotics can help to regulate metabolic processes and promote weight management.

Moreover, prebiotics have been shown to enhance the production of certain immune cells, such as T cells and natural killer cells, which are responsible for fighting off infections and supporting overall immune function.

In addition to their direct effects on the immune system, prebiotics also indirectly support immune health by improving gut barrier function. A strong gut barrier prevents the entry of harmful pathogens into the body, reducing the risk of infections and supporting overall well-being.

Potential Side Effects and Considerations of Prebiotics

While prebiotics offer numerous health benefits, it is important to be aware of potential side effects and considerations when increasing your prebiotic intake.

Precautions When Increasing Prebiotic Intake

Some individuals may experience temporary digestive discomfort, such as bloating or gas, when first increasing their prebiotic intake. This is usually a temporary reaction as your gut adjusts to the increased fiber.

If you have a pre-existing gastrointestinal condition, such as irritable bowel syndrome (IBS), it is recommended to consult with a healthcare professional before significantly increasing your prebiotic consumption.
